Product Description

by Cassandra McGinnity (Author)

It may seem rather archaic to see life in only black and white, but that's what a decade-long career in ultrasound looks like. Exactly 256 shades of gray projected onto a monitor. Every single pixel and sound wave coming together to form an image that will determine the fate of so many lives. Waves follows one day in the life of Cassie, a high risk prenatal sonographer. Hour by hour, patient by patient, she travels through the multiple emotions and chronicles during pregnancy. A complex, yet invaluable story that reveals all the raw feelings and chaos that occurs during a woman's reproductive journey. From joyous excitement to utter devastation; Cassie begins to blur the lines between healthcare and human care. Challenged at times by the healthcare system, she also must navigate her role in ultrasound not only as a provider but as a companion. Her medical career is explored in this up close and personal memoir, that is bound to teach us all something worth knowing.
